Clinical and MRI scale to predict very poor outcome in tissue plasminogen activator patients
Kazumi Kimura1, Yuki Sakamoto, Yasuyuki Iguchi
1Department of Stroke Medicine, Kawasaki Medical School, Kurashiki City, Japan. kimurak @ med.kawasaki-m.ac.jp
Background And Purpose:
The present study aimed to devise a simple scale to predict very poor outcome after tissue plasminogen activator (t-PA) therapy using clinical and MRI factors.
Methods:
Consecutive stroke patients treated with t-PA within 3 h of onset were studied prospectively. Clinical factors and MRI findings independently associated with very poor outcome (modified Rankin Scale score 4-6) at 3 months after t-PA therapy were assessed.
Results:
The subjects were 117 patients. Multivariate logistic regression analysis revealed the following independent factors associated with very poor outcome: time from stroke onset to treatment ≥140 min (OR 2.790, 95% CI 1.082-7.193; p = 0.0337), baseline National Institutes of Health Stroke Scale score ≥20 (OR 3.794, 95% CI 1.199-12.009; p = 0.0233), glucose ≥180 mg/dl (OR 3.288, 95% CI 1.126-9.600; p = 0.0295), internal carotid artery occlusion (OR 6.187, 95% CI 5.090-18.354; p = 0.0129) and M1 susceptibility vessel sign (OR 6.379, 95% CI 1.194-34.074; p = 0.030). Those 5 variables were selected in the scale, with each factor as 1 point. Frequencies of patients with a very poor outcome for each score were as follows: score 0, 26.3%; score 1, 30.6%; score 2, 70.0%, and score 3-5, 100%.
Conclusion:
A clinical scale using clinical and MRI factors can predict very poor outcome in t-PA patients.
